HotelExtended Stay HotelHome2 Suites
Located off I-49, our pet-friendly suites are just across the road from NorthWest Arkansas Community College. Enjoy art and the outdoors at Crystal Bridges Museum of American Art and The Momentary, 10 minutes away. Walmart HQ and downtown Bentonville are also 10 minutes from us. With nearly 4,000 sq. ft. of event space, our hotel is great for meetings.

Frequently Asked Questions About Home2 Suites by Hilton Bentonville Rogers

What are the check-in and check-out times at Home2 Suites by Hilton Bentonville Rogers?

Check-in time is at 3:00 PM, and check-out time is at 11:00 AM.

Is Home2 Suites by Hilton Bentonville Rogers pet-friendly?

Yes, both cats and dogs are welcome at the hotel.
